A Different Approach to the Touring Exhibition Model
Traditional touring exhibitions depend on the physical transport of exhibition builds between venues, often involving long lead times and complex logistics. Printable Touring Exhibitions offers a different solution.
Exhibitions are licensed digitally, with host venues receiving a complete exhibition package that is printed and installed locally. Clear design, production, and interpretation guidelines ensure curatorial and visual consistency, while eliminating international freight, customs clearance, and transport-related constraints. In this way, exhibitions can tour internationally without physically travelling.
Designed for Contemporary Programming Needs
The printable touring model has been developed to support a range of institutional requirements:
- Adaptable spatial layouts
Exhibitions are modular and typically suitable for spaces of approximately 80ā200 square metres. - Flexible presentation periods
Licences can be structured for shorter presentations or longer seasonal runs. - Suitable for short-notice programming
Because exhibitions are licensed digitally and produced locally, the model is particularly well suited to venues needing to fill last-minute programme gaps without the lead times associated with traditional touring exhibitions. - Reduced environmental impact
Removing international shipping significantly lowers touring exhibitionsā carbon footprint.
